- >Once the device driver kit comes out, I think porting the MGR window
- >system would be an excellent idea. This will require graphics drivers
- >that implement the standard bitblt operations for various boards , as
- >well as mouse drivers.
- >
- >The actual port of the Bellcore window manager code is probably best
- >done by a single person. But, if a device driver interface is
- >defined, the graphics drivers could be written separately. Once the
- >core package is ported the various client programs (there aren't too
- >many) could also be ported separately.

- This sounds like a great idea to me too. Where can the source code for MGR be
- found? I have found the sources for MGR under linux everywhere and for minix
- too, but I cannot find the general distribution. I will start looking at the
- linux MGR sources tonight. If someone knows of a better set of sources, please
- let me know.
-
- I guess we will all need to write drivers for our different video cards unless
- we want to stick with a set of standard modes. What do people think about the
- video modes we should use? I for one would like 640x480x16 standard VGA. This
- is the first one I will try to write.
-
- Once I have looked at the source (and you can too!) we should discuss how it
- might be parcelled out if others want to help. It looks big enough that a
- group effort would be beneficial (at least it should speed things up a little).
- Anyone else want to take a crack at MGR?
-
- A mouse driver for Microsoft Mouse is listed as one of the drivers already
- included in the device driver kit. Thus we shouldn't need to write that unless
- people have wierd mice. (Most mice are Microsoft Mouse compatible.)
-
- I have not looked at the source for MGR yet, but since it has been ported to
- Minix386, I assume it doesn't need any sockets or TCP/IP?
